The intersection of quantum geometry, matrix theory, and gravity represents a cutting-edge area of theoretical physics, aimed at resolving some of the most profound questions about the universe. A significant resource for understanding this complex field is the recently published book "Quantum Geometry, Matrix Theory, and Gravity" by Harold C. Steinacker.
